Stephen Mc-clain in the US
We found 1 people named Stephen Mc-clain with email addresses, mobile phone numbers, USA home addresses and more.
Stephen Mc Clain
1909 Lamar Av, Mt Vernon, IL 62864 is where Stephen resides. Nicole Hollenkamp and Charles Wright are the persons who are associated with this address
Lives:
- Nicole Hollenkamp
- Charles Wright
Address:
1909 Lamar Ave, Mt Vernon, IL 62864
House Type:
Single Family
Report ID:
62704ea3d4b45c75e082e530
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ks